Origin
The name "SnowFlake" likely derives from the exquisite, delicate beauty of a snowflake—those tiny ice crystals that somehow manage to make winter both magical and inconvenient. The name captures:
- Snow - Representing purity, fresh starts, and also a chilly demeanor if we're talking personalities.
- Flake - Suggesting uniqueness (since no two are alike!) but also perhaps a hint at being a bit unpredictable or flaky, in a charming way.
Cultural Significance
- Individuality: Each snowflake is unique, making the name ideal for someone who prides themselves on being one-of-a-kind.
- Gentle Strength: Snowflakes are soft but can still cause a blizzard. A subtle nod to quiet power?
- Trendiness: SnowFlake might also reference modern slang, where it describes someone sensitive or easily offended—though let’s hope not!
